Direction (Q. 101 110): Read the following passage and answer the following questions.
The cabinet of our country has banned on sale of cigarette to the minors (children below 18
years of age). Even the sale and storage of cigarettes, within the radius of 50 meters around
school, colleges, and other educational institutions will not be allowed. These decisions were
effected from January 1 2012. Both these norms have been made a penal offence and those
caught violating them always face a fine of Rs. 500 and imprisonment up to three months. The
complaints lodged against these cases are investigated by officers of the rank of sub inspector.
The health department has appointed the agency to implement the city cabinets decision. This
decision of cabinet will take help from the local police in removing cigarettes shops near school
and colleges. At present restrictions exist only on sale of liquor around schools and colleges.
And it is for the first time that the government has focused its attention towards curbing sale of
cigarettes near these institutions. Observers are skeptical about the success of the move to
discourage smoking among minors. These resolutions will certainly help in controlling the
smoking among youngsters.
Our cabinet was enforced to take these decisions as recent studies conducted by the health
department revealed that a large number of youngsters, particularly those below the age of 18
are involved in smoking. Sources said the government is likely to take some more measures
over next few months to check sale of cigarettes. In addition, some of the existing clauses of
the anti smoking act including ban on smoking places will be more stringent.

Direction (Q. 111 120): Read the following passage and answer the following questions.
Price Rise is one of the crucial issues for country like India. Since many years, price rise has
become a persistent woe in India's national life. It has given spread to widespread distress
among the citizens, who are earning at the subsistence level and also have fixed earnings
comprising labor class and salary earners. Due to continuous rises in prices of necessary
products, the number of people below poverty line is increasing at an alarming rate. According
to data, it has been observed that around 60 percent of our population is facing chronic
problem of price rise in the country.

There are varied factors that tremendously contribute to Price Rise in the country namely
External Factors and Internal Factors. We have heard it many times that price rise in our
country is due to impact of global inflation. Obviously, we cannot effort much for it as it is a
matter of world economy. But at our end, we can identify and strive to mitigate the problems
arise from internal factors which may be aggravating the situation. This signifies a state of
imbalance in economy of the country, which arise due to distinctive factors; inadequate supply
of goods, improper planning strategies, weaker export and import policies and so on.

Thus, we concludes that there few internal factors precipitating increase in price, which are
excess money supply, imbalance in production, selfishness among traders and undue increase
in population. It is a high time for the government to take some concrete measure to manage
the problem.
